One clear sign of a heating emergency is a complete system failure during cold weather. If your furnace or heat pump stops producing warm air entirely, especially during a cold front, professional service should be scheduled as soon as possible. Extended exposure to low indoor temperatures can create discomfort and potential health concerns.

Unusual smells or sounds can also signal the need for urgent repair. Strong burning odors, gas like smells, or loud banging noises should never be ignored. Homeowners researching When to Call for Emergency Heating Repair in Ventura County should treat these warning signs seriously, as they may indicate electrical issues, gas leaks, or mechanical failures that require immediate professional inspection.

Frequent system shutdowns or short cycling during cold weather can also signal an emergency. When a heating system struggles to maintain consistent temperatures, internal components may be under stress. Continuing to operate a malfunctioning unit can worsen damage and increase repair costs.

Safety concerns are another important factor. If you notice carbon monoxide detector alerts, pilot light irregularities, or visible damage to your heating system, shut the unit off and contact a licensed HVAC technician immediately. Emergency heating issues often involve gas connections or ventilation pathways that require expert handling.
